Tetris 99’s 27th Maximus Cup event features Mario Party Superstars
Through this coming weekend, players can compete in Tetris 99 to earn a new theme with art, music, and tetromino pieces based on Mario Party Superstars.
A couple years after its launch, Tetris 99 is still going strong with its battle royale-meets-Tetris formula. Nintendo and Arika have supported the game with 26 Maximus Cup events so far, usually alongside prominent Nintendo game releases, and a 27th Maximus Cup is coming this weekend. This time around, it will be featuring the recently released Mario Party Superstars as players battle it out to earn points for a new theme.
The #Tetris99 27th MAXIMUS CUP event will run from 11pm PT, December, 9 – 10:59pm PT, on December 13!
Once you’ve accumulated a total of 100 event points, a new theme will unlock, featuring art, music, and Tetrimino designs inspired by the #MarioParty Superstars game! pic.twitter.com/DTuUSAKJsZ
